Overall appearance: Incomplete specimen with 37 segment, first 3 segments dorsally inflated
Peristomial cirri: absent
Branchiae a/p: absent (at least in 37 chaetigers)
Antennae: 5, with ceratophores compsed of 3 rings
Anterior chaetae: include barely pseudocompound hooks with elongate hyaline hoods
Other chaetae: chunky bidnetate, sub-acicular, hooded hooks are present from Ch 9?(broken), clearly seen from Ch 10.
Remarks
This specimen corresponds well with Notonuphis antatrcita, Monro 1930.
